Several other profiles on X shared the video with the claim that the singer had set herself on fire at the 2026 Met Gala. However, it was soon revealed that the video of Katy was not from the gala. It was noted that the outfit Katy wore in the video differed from her Met Gala ensemble. According to reports, the alleged video was actually from Katy's WATCH IT BURN music video behind the scenes. X (formerly Twitter)'s AI bot, Grok, also fact-checked the claims as many began to express concerns about the singer's well-being. The AI chatbot was quoted as saying:
"She's fine. That's not Katy Perry—it's old behind-the-scenes footage of a controlled fire stunt from the 2023 telenovela Vuelve a Mi. Safety crew, cameras, and extinguishers are all over the set. Katy attended the 2026 Met Gala last night in a white Stella McCartney gown and a silver mask. No fire, no burns. Classic viral mix-up!"
